It's funny how useful and grin inducing having a nearly unlimited supply of cheap ink is. One of my friends needed lots of different colors of construction paper to make some paper projects. And her jaws just dropped when I said don't bother buying any I'll just print what you need, I have some heavy thickness paper and I'll just print whatever colors you need, even if she wanted leopard print which I ended up printing anyways. It's amazing how much of a stranglehold printer ink has on peoples' perception. By her reaction to me printing page after page of solid colors you'd have thought she was thinking I was burning $100 bills. I told her my printer needed the exercise anyways since it's been almost a week since I printed anything. I had to show her the CISS in the back of the printer that made it all possible. She wanted one too but I told her they were too fiddly and require regular maintenance, and just recently I had to reprime mine cause I was uncomfortable with the amount of air in the cartridges. So I told her it probably wasn't a good idea to just go out and buy a CISS unless you're really dedicated to printing.
